Bagging Up<br />

Objectives<br />

This <strong>SOP</strong> is designed to ensure that dispensed prescriptions are bagged up accurately before<br />

being transferred to the customer.<br />

This <strong>SOP</strong> will:<br />

• Ensure the correct products are placed in the prescription bag<br />

• The completed prescription bag is stored in the correct location<br />

• Any split packs, bulk packs of medication remaining after the dispensing process are<br />

returned to the appropriate area<br />

Scope<br />

This <strong>SOP</strong> will cover all NHS and private prescriptions that are dispensed but not<br />

prescriptions that are to be dispensed for monitored dosage systems such as MDS or CDS.<br />

Responsibility<br />

Members of staff responsible for this process should be listed in the Record of Competence.<br />

Only those members of staff listed are to be considered competent to carry out this<br />

procedure. No other member of staff should be asked to carry out any part of this process.<br />

Review<br />

The <strong>SOP</strong> will be reviewed annually, when there are any changes to legislation affecting the<br />

process, or in the event of any change of staff, or any increase or decrease in the<br />

competence level of the staff. The <strong>SOP</strong> should also be reviewed following a critical incident.<br />

The responsibility for reviewing the <strong>SOP</strong> rests with the Pharmacy Manager (Pharmacist), or<br />

in their absence, the Pharmacist or Pharmacy Manager (non-Pharmacist). In the absence of<br />

these members of staff, the Area Manager will be responsible for review.<br />

If as a result of the review any changes to the <strong>SOP</strong> are deemed necessary, these must be<br />

approved by the Superintendent’s Department. For any changes to the <strong>SOP</strong> an application<br />

must be submitted, in writing, explaining in detail the changes deemed necessary and the<br />

reasoning behind these changes. The application should be sent by post to the<br />

Superintendent’s Department, at Sapphire Court.<br />

Associated Risks<br />

Care must be taken when bagging up medication to ensure only the products associated<br />

with the relevant prescription are placed in the bag. Any split/bulk packs remaining must be<br />

clearly segregated.<br />

A separate bag must be used for each individual patient<br />
